What Experts Agree On
What Experts Love
- ✓ Z-Wave frequency avoids Wi-Fi congestion for reliable alerts
- ✓ 3-year battery life with CR2032 cells
- ✓ Slim design fits any door or window frame
- ✓ Native Ring Alarm integration with professional monitoring option
- ✓ 4.7/5 stars from 28,000+ Amazon reviews
Common Criticisms
- ✗ Requires Ring Alarm Base Station to function
- ✗ Z-Wave is Ring-proprietary — no path to other platforms
- ✗ No Matter or Thread support
